1.Expression of Th1、Th2-typed cytokines and its significance in nasal polyps
Huabin LI ; Geng XU ; Yuan LI ; Mingqiang XIE ; Gehua ZHANG
Journal of Clinical Otorhinolaryngology Head and Neck Surgery 2001;(2):51-52
Objective:To evaluate the possible role of cytokines in pathophysiology and treatment of nasal polyps.Method:The expressions of Th1-typed cytokines IFN-γ、IL-2 、IL-12 and Th2-typed cytokines IL-4、IL-5、IL-8、IL-10、IL-13 were investigated with enzyme-linked immune sorbent assay(ELISA) in 25 patients with nasal polyps.Result:There was a significant upregulation of Th2-typed cytokines IL-4、IL-5、IL-8、IL-10、IL-13 in nasal polyps compared with normal nasal mucosa, especially IL-4 and IL-5 (3.9 times and 8.8 times higher than normal mucous respectively) while the expression of Th1-typed cytokines IFN-γ、IL-2、IL-12 drcreased after treated with local glucocorticoid. The levels of Th2-typed cytokines decreased significantly and Th1-typed cytokines had no obvious change.Conclusion:The upregulation of Th2-typed cytokines such as IL-4、IL-5、IL-8、IL-10、IL-12 may play an important role in the pathophysiology of nasal polyps and Th2-typed cytokines can be viewed as a target of treatment to nasal polyps.
2.Analysis on Government Health Investment Process in Shanxi:an example of central special funds
Yunxia ZHANG ; Mei LI ; Jing YUAN ; Xinli GENG
Chinese Health Economics 2013;(11):49-50
Objective: To find out existed problems in government health investment process, it needs to increase efficiency rate of government health investment’s special fund. Methods: Through making statistics on the efficiency rate of central special funds in Shanxi government health investment, and analysis on the appropriate process of financial department of all levels. Results: Central government special funds distribution interval is too long, efficiency rate is low. Conclusion: It needs to accelerate special fund distribution and to carry out financial management model from province to county and enhance financial supervision.
3.Effects of Electroacupuncture plus Oxygenmedicine on the Expression of Bcl-2 and Bax Proteins in the Hippocampal CA 1 Area in Rats with Global Cerebral Ischemia/Reperfusion Injury
Yuan BU ; Peiying ZHANG ; Deqin GENG ; Jinxia CAO ; Jizhen LI
Acupuncture Research 2010;0(03):-
Objective To observe the effect of electroacupuncture (EA) plus oxygenmedicine (OM) on the expression of Bcl-2 and Bax in the hippocampal CA 1 area in cerebral ischemia/reperfusion injury (CI/RI) rats. Methods Thirty SD rats were randomized into sham-operation,model,EA,OM,EA+OM groups (n=6/group). CI/RI model was established by using modified Pulsinelli 4 vessel occlusion and reperfusion. EA (100 Hz,3.5 mA) was applied to "Baihui" (GV 20) and "Zusanli" (ST 36) 30 min,once daily for 4 days. Rats of OM and EA+OM groups were put into a box filled with oxygen and atomized herbal medicines containing Bingpian (Borneolum),Shexiang (Moschus),Huangjing (Rhizoma Polygonati),Shouwu (Radix Polygoni Multiflori),etc. for 30 min,once daily for 4 days. Bcl-2 and Bax expression of the hippocampal CA 1 area was detected by immunohistochemistry. Results Compared with sham group,the numbers of Bcl-2 immunoreaction (IR) and Bax IR positive cells,and the immunoactivity of Bcl-2 IR and Bax IR positive products in the hippocampal CA 1 area were increased significantly in model group (P0.05). Conclusion EA and OM and EA+OM can effectively regulate the expression of Bcl-2 and Bax in the hippocampal CA 1 area in CI/RI rats,and the effects of EA+OM are significantly superior to those of simple EA and simple OM,which may contribute to their effect in improving cerebral ischemia.
4.Application of stem cell transplantation in repair of the retinal ganglion cells injury
Xin, RONG ; Hui-Yuan, HOU ; Geng, GUO ; Hui, ZHANG
International Eye Science 2014;(7):1223-1226
The progressive injury of retinal ganglion cells ( RGCs) is a common occurrence in several eye diseases, which ultimately may lead to irreversible blindness. Currently, there are still no effective or ideal treatments for it in practice, however some recent studies show that stem cell transplantation may provide a promising new idea for neuroprotection and replacement of retinal ganglion cells. This paper will review the research progress of stem cell transplantation-based treatment.
5.The study of establishing the chimerism through vascularized ilium transplantation animal model
Di WEI ; Geng ZHANG ; Fei YAN ; Jieheng WU ; Keke ZHANG ; Lei ZHANG ; Jianlin YUAN
Chinese Journal of Urology 2017;38(4):305-309
Objective To construct an animal model of vascularized iliac bone transplantation which could establish the immune chimerism.Methods The experiment was divided into three groups.In experiment group we slected the male SD rats as donors and the female SD rats as recipients.Then the experiment group was performed the improved vascularized ilium transplantation operation.The positive group was male SD rats without handling.The negative group was female SD rats without handling.On the twenty-eighth day after surgery, the rat SRY gene was detected by PCR.Dynamically monitoring the changes of the ratio of CD4+/CD8+ T cells by flow cytometry after operation.Dynamically monitoring the changes of the levels of serum IL-2 by enzyme linked immunosorbent assay after operation.Imaging and pathology were used to detect the transplanted iliac bone.Results Ten transplantations were performed in the experiment group and 7 flaps survived with a successful rate of 73 %.SRY gene was detected in female rats that receive the male rats'iliac bone transplantation by PCR in the experiment group.After Micro-CT scanning and three-dimensional reconstruction, it showed that the transplanted iliac bone mineral density was decreased.Comparing rats that establish the chimerism with normal rats, the ratio of CD4 +/CD8 + T cells and the levels of serum IL-2 had no difference.Pathological results showed that the transplanted iliac bone of rats with chimerism were normal and the rats without chimerism were necrotic.Conclusions From the improved vascularized ilium transplantation operation, we successfully detected the SRY gene in female rats which received the male rats' iliac bone transplantation.It proved that the improved vascularized ilium transplantation operation could establish the chimerism.Through the immunosuppressant, the immune status of the rat after operation was well.
6.Transcranial magnetic stimulation promotes proliferation of endogenous neural stem cells of Parkinson’s disease model mice
Ping GU ; Zhongxia ZHANG ; Qinying MA ; Yuan GENG ; Yanyong WANG ; Lina ZHANG ; Mingwei WANG
Chinese Journal of Tissue Engineering Research 2013;(45):7939-7946
BACKGROUND:Neurotoxin 1-methyl-4-phenyl-1,2,3,6-tetrahydropyridine can induce the clinical, biochemical and pathological characteristics similar to those observed in primary Parkinson’s disease. OBJECTIVE:To observe the effects of rep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ation on the proliferation of endogenous neural stem cells of Parkinson’s disease model mice and the mood change.
METHODS:A total of 72 male C57BL/6J mice were randomly divided into four groups:normal saline group, Parkinson’s disease model group (model group), sham-rep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ation group (sham group) and rep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ation group. The mice received 1-methyl-4-phenyl-1,2,3,6-tetrahydropyridine injection×4 to establish acute Parkinson’s disease models. The mice in the normal saline group were injected the same volume saline. And 24 hours after the last injection of 1-methyl-4-phenyl-1,2,3, 6-tetrahydropyridine, the mice in the rep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ation group received five trains of rep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ation, 1 Hz for 25 seconds, at an intensity of 1 Tesla daily for 1, 3, 7 consecutive days. Sham group mice were not exposed to the magnetic field. No treatment was performed in the mice of model group. The mood change was evaluated using the elevated-plus maze testing before and after rep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ation treatment. The change in expression of nestin in the subventricular zone was observed by using immunohistochemical technique.
RESULTS AND CONCLUSION:(1) Elevated-plus maze testing:There was no statistical significance about percentage of opening arm time accounting for total time among groups and at different time points in each group, but after stimulation, the percentage of opening arm time accounting for total time showed a declined tendency. (2) The results of nestin immunohistochemical staining:Compared to the normal saline group, the number of nestin-positive cells of the model group was increased at days 3 and 7, and there was no statistical significance in the number of nestin-positive cells between model group and sham group;Compared to the sham group and model group, the number of nestin-positive cells of rep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ation group were evidently increased;The proliferation of endogenous neural stem cells was time-dependent, endogenous neural stem cells exhibited outward migration gradual y along the certain way, and some cells were able to migrate to the corpus cal osum at day 3, and even to the cerebral cortex at day 7. Rep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ation can promote the endogenous neural stem cells in a time-depended manner.
7.A Pharmacodynamical Study on the Improvement of Senile Drosophilas with Fragmented Sleep with the Administration of Shuang Xia Decoction
Yuan XI ; Qi ZHANG ; Yan TIAN ; Zhiqian ZHANG ; Di GENG ; Hongying LIN
World Science and Technology-Modernization of Traditional Chinese Medicine 2016;18(11):1993-2000
This study aimed at unfolding the therapeutic effects of freeze-dried powder separated from Shuang Xia decoction (SXD) on female senile drosophila melanogaster with fragmented sleep.Taking drosophilas as the model organisms,the locomotor activity was monitored using the autonomic monitoring software to explore the regulation of fragmented sleep in senile drosophilas by the treatment of SXD.As a result,it was found that the optimum concentration of SXD was 2.50%,while the desirable therapeutic duration was 4 days.In comparison with the control group,35-day-old virgin drosophilas'sleep was prolonged in the SXD group and the positive control group.The positive drug mainly affected their sleep in the daytime,while SXD impacted their sleep at night featuring the prolonged fragmented sleep.In conclusion,it was demonstrated that the freeze-dried powder of SXD effectively alleviated intermittent insomnia in the female senile drosophilas.Compared with positive drug,SXD also mitigated intermittent insomnia at night without significant changes in the sleep of the drosophilas in the daytime.Above all,SXD was beneficial in the regulation of sleep-wake rhythm in the drosophilas.
8.Bilateral mandibular second molar impaction with paradental cyst:A case report and literature review
Jing LI ; Yuan LI ; Jinfang XIE ; Wentao GENG ; Xuebin GAO ; Na WANG ; Yingli ZHANG
Journal of Jilin University(Medicine Edition) 2017;43(2):422-424
Objective:To explore the etiology and treatment of one case of bilateral mandibular second molar impaction with paradental cyst, and to provide a reference for its diagnosis and treatment. Methods:Root canal treatment of the left mandibular first molar of the patient was performed before operation.The left mandibular second molar of the patient was removed;the residual dental follicle, the granulation tissue and the cyst wall were stroken off under local anesthesia.The diamond ball was used to polish the wound cavity and sharp bone edge, and to mill the distal apical part of left mandibular first molar.The tissue removed during the procedure was used for the pathological examination.Results:The X-ray image showed that the bilateral mandibular second molar was impacted with the left mandibular first molar root's absorption, and there was a clear round-like density reduction zone around the second molar crown.The pathologic result was paradental cyst.Conclusion:Dental impaction complicated with paradental cyst could occur in other tooth position except for the third molar.Its diagnosis should be combined with the clinical manifestations, the pathologic manifestations and the medical imaging.Multidisciplinary consultation is in favor of its diagnosis and treatment.
9.Morphology of the intervertebral disc in high fat combined with streptozotocin-induced type Ⅱ diabetic rats
Guangyuan LIU ; Muwei DAI ; Faming TIAN ; Leiliang YUAN ; Lindan GENG ; Mingjian BEI ; Liu ZHANG ; Wenya WANG
Chinese Journal of Tissue Engineering Research 2017;21(12):1883-1888
BACKGROUND:Rat models of diabetes mellitus type 2 (T2DM) are usually induced by the combination of high-fat diet and low-dose streptozotocin, but their effects on the intervertebral disc have not yet been reported. Endplate sclerosis is an important factor contributing to intervertebral disc degeneration. OBJECTIVE:To evaluate whether the rat T2DM model induced by high-fat diet combined with low-dose streptozotocin is suitable for the study of T2DM related intervertebral disc degeneration. METHODS:Thirty-two 3-month-old female Sprague-Dawley rats were divided into four groups (n=8 per group), including sham, bilateral variectomy, DM, and bilateral variectomy plus DM groups, followed by subjected to bilateral ovariectomy and/or high-fat diet combined with low-dose streptozotocin, respectively. The blood glucose level, body mass and glucose tolerance were determined. The bone mineral density of the lumbar spine was measured after 8-week streptozotocin treatment. The L5-6 segments were removed and cut through midst sagittal plane after decalcification, and then underwent Von Gieson staining and histological degeneration scoring, and the disc height and endplate thickness were measured. RESULTS AND CONCLUSION:Fasting blood glucose and random blood glucose levels in the DM and bilateral variectomy plus DM groups were significantly higher than those in the other two groups, and the insulin sensitivity in the DM and bilateral variectomy plus DM groups were significantly lower than that in the other groups (P<0.05). L4-6 vertebral bone mineral density in the bilateral variectomy group was significantly lower than that in the sham group (P<0.05);L5-6 vertebral bone mineral density in the DM and bilateral variectomy plus DM groups was significantly lower than that in the sham group (P<0.05). L5-6 vertebral histological scores in the DM and bilateral variectomy plus DM groups were significantly higher than those in the other groups (P<0.05). Similar with the bilateral variectomy group, there were chondrometaplasia and mucoid degeneration of nucleus pulposus cells in the bilateral variectomy plus DM group, and the histological scores were significantly higher than those in the sham and DM groups (P<0.05). Compared with the sham group, the intervertebral disc height in the bilateral variectomy and bilateral variectomy plus DM groups was significantly decreased (P<0.05). While, there was no significant difference in the endplate thickness among groups. These results indicate the combination of high-fat diet and low-dose streptozotocin-induced rat T2DM models possess diabetic characteristics, but the rat intervertebral disc tissues show no significant differences from the normal ones;therefore, this model may be unsuitable for the study on T2DM-related intervertebral disc degeneration.
10.Design, synthesis and evaluation of N-acyl-4-phenylthiazole-2-amines as acetylcholinesterase inhibitors.
Zheng-Yue MA ; Qi YANG ; Yuan-Gong ZHANG ; Jun-Jie LI ; Geng-Liang YANG
Acta Pharmaceutica Sinica 2014;49(6):813-818
N-Acyl-4-phenylthiazole-2-amines were designed and synthesized, moreover their effects on acetylcholinesterase activities were tested. N-Acyl-4-phenylthiazole-2-amines were prepared from substituted 2-bromo-1-acetophenones by three steps reaction, and their AChE inhibitory activities were measured by Ellman method in vitro. The results showed that the target compounds had a certain inhibitory activity on AChE in vitro. Among them, 8c was the best, and IC50 of 8c was 0.51 micromol x L(-1), better than that of rivastigmine and Huperzine-A. The inhibitory activities of N-acyl-4-phenylthiazole-2-amines on acetylcholinesterase are worth while to be further studied.
